Automotive video has its own conventions. Rolling shots from a chase car, drone tracks, slow reveals, and a lighting setup that flatters paint. The videographers that do this well usually own the rigs themselves or work with the same fixers every time.

If you are commissioning a car film for a launch or a dealership campaign, send the brief along with any vehicle restrictions (no public road shoots, no track time, etc) at the first contact. That avoids two-thirds of the back-and-forth. The teams listed here work with car brands, dealerships, classic car specialists and automotive media outlets.
